WYSIWYG = What you see is what you get. ?This is what most folks use. ?You turn on bold and you immediately see your selection in bold, without any special formatting characters being displayed.
With Markdown you enter special characters in your writing indicating you want something to be bold. ?From what I¡¯ve read, Bear only shows the final formatted document after you export it. ?For example, you would see the following in your note...
*this will be in bold* and /this will be in italics/
but you would not see the characters in bold or italics until after it has been exported. ?That is presuming that what I read was true. ?Bear has keyboard shortcuts available to make using Markdown simpler. ?
